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Las Vegas to Grand Sierra Resort is to drive which costs $75 - $120 and takes 7h 44m.
The fastest way to get from Las Vegas to Grand Sierra Resort is to fly which takes 3h 8m and costs $140 - $440.
No, there is no direct bus from Las Vegas to Grand Sierra Resort. However, there are services departing from South Strip Transit Terminal and arriving at Reno - Tahoe International Airport via Mojave - Carl's Jr., 44812 Sierra Highway and Bishop - Vons/Kmart, 1200 N. Main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 15h 27m.
The distance between Las Vegas and Grand Sierra Resort is 354 miles. The road distance is 425 miles.
